The Oklahoma City Thunder are 8-11 and the Houston Rockets are 4-14. The Thunder won their last game 123-119 over the Bulls. Houston finished the last season with the worst record in the Western Conference and in all of the NBA at 17-55.  The Thunder-Rockets game is part of our NBA odds series.

The Thunder are slowly but surely putting together the pieces to be a threat in the league in years to come. They have a surplus of young talent and a breakout star in Shai Gilgeous-Alexander. He scored 31 points against Chicago and made 14 of his 15 free-throw attempts. The Thunder played an aggressive brand of basketball and they made it to the charity stripe 32 times in their win over Chicago.

The Houston Rockets are playing against the Thunder. Houston has played most of their games away from home. The Rockets beat the Atlanta Hawks yesterday. They out-rebounded the Hawks by a margin of 59-28. Their field goal percentage is 44%, which is the worst in the league.

The Rockets are hoping to continue their momentum from last night's win. Jalen Green scored 30 points for the Rockets. Shai Gilgeous-Alexander needs to step up to keep up with Green.
